苹果编程软件叫什么
-
苹果的编程软件主要有两个,一个是Xcode,另一个是Swift Playgrounds。
Xcode是苹果官方推出的集成开发环境(IDE),用于开发macOS、iOS、watchOS和tvOS应用程序。它支持多种编程语言,包括C、C++、Objective-C以及Swift。Xcode提供了丰富的工具和功能,例如代码编辑器、界面设计工具、调试器等,可以帮助开发者在一个统一的界面中完成整个应用程序的开发过程。
Swift Playgrounds是苹果专为初学者设计的编程学习工具,旨在教授Swift编程语言。它是一种互动式学习环境,可以通过在iPad上编写代码来学习编程基础。Swift Playgrounds提供了一个友好的用户界面和一系列的学习任务,帮助用户逐步学习和掌握Swift语言的概念和技巧。
总而言之,苹果的编程软件主要有Xcode和Swift Playgrounds,分别适用于开发专业级的应用程序和初学者学习编程。
1年前 -
苹果的编程软件主要分为两大类:Xcode和Swift Playgrounds。
-
Xcode是苹果公司官方提供的集成开发环境(IDE),用于开发和编译所有的苹果操作系统和应用程序。Xcode支持多种编程语言,包括C、C++、Objective-C和Swift。它具有强大的代码编辑和调试功能,并提供了丰富的开发工具和框架,同时还可以进行应用程序的测试、打包和发布等功能。
-
Swift Playgrounds是苹果公司开发的一款专为初学者设计的交互式编程学习工具。它提供了一个可视化编程环境,通过简单的拖拽和编写代码块的方式,引导用户学习和掌握Swift编程语言。Swift Playgrounds还提供了丰富的教程和挑战,帮助用户逐步提升编程技能。
此外,苹果还提供了其他一些开发工具和框架,如Core Data、SpriteKit和Metal等,用于开发不同类型的应用程序,包括iOS、macOS、watchOS和tvOS应用。开发者可以根据自己的需求选择合适的工具和框架来进行开发。
1年前 -
-
苹果官方的编程软件主要有两个,一个是Xcode,另一个是Swift Playgrounds。
- Xcode:Xcode是使用苹果开发的集成开发环境(IDE),用于开发iOS、macOS、watchOS和tvOS应用程序。使用Xcode,可以编写、调试和构建应用程序,并且还有一个界面建设器(Interface Builder),可以方便地创建用户界面。
操作流程:
-
下载和安装Xcode:可以在Mac App Store上搜索Xcode并下载安装。
-
打开Xcode:将Xcode应用程序拖放到Applications文件夹中,然后在Launchpad或Applications文件夹中找到Xcode应用程序并打开它。
-
创建新项目:在Xcode中,通过选择File -> New -> Project来创建新的项目。然后选择所需的应用程序模板,并提供项目的名称和其他设置。
-
开发应用程序:使用Xcode提供的各种工具、模板和资源开始编写代码和构建应用程序。
-
调试和测试:Xcode提供了强大的调试工具,可以帮助找到和修复应用程序中的错误。同时,还提供了模拟器来测试应用程序在不同设备上的运行情况。
-
构建和部署:完成应用程序的开发和测试后,可以使用Xcode将应用程序构建为可部署的包,并将其上传到App Store或其他平台上进行发布。
-
Swift Playgrounds:Swift Playgrounds是一个交互式的学习和实验环境,可以帮助初学者学习Swift编程语言,并进行简单的编程实践。
操作流程:
- 下载和安装Swift Playgrounds:可以在App Store上搜索Swift Playgrounds并下载安装。
- 打开Swift Playgrounds:在Launchpad或主屏幕中找到Swift Playgrounds应用程序并打开它。
- 学习和实践编程:Swift Playgrounds提供了一系列的学习和实践内容,从基本的编程概念到更高级的主题。通过跟随课程和练习,可以逐步学习和掌握Swift编程语言。
- 创建和运行代码:在Swift Playgrounds中,可以创建新的代码文件,并使用Swift语言编写代码。然后,可以通过点击“运行”按钮来执行代码,并在画布上看到代码的结果。
- 练习和挑战:Swift Playgrounds还提供了一系列的练习和挑战,以巩固和应用所学的编程知识。通过完成这些练习和挑战,可以提高编程技能。
总结:
无论是Xcode还是Swift Playgrounds,都是苹果提供的编程软件,用于开发和学习苹果平台上的应用程序。Xcode适用于有一定编程经验的开发者,提供了广泛的功能和工具来支持应用程序的开发和调试。而Swift Playgrounds则面向初学者,提供了一个交互式的学习环境,帮助用户学习和实践编程。1年前